Band D council tax by billing authority
In Woking, band D council tax by billing authority rose from £2,027 in the year ending March 2021 to £2,598 in the year ending March 2027, a change of £571 or 28.1%, in cash terms, not adjusted for inflation (MHCLG).
This series begins in the year ending March 2021, after 2017, so the comparison starts there. Nothing earlier is published for this area.

Median annual pay, full-time employees, by area of residence
In Woking, median annual pay, full-time employees, by area of residence rose from £36,134 in 2017 to £43,719 in 2025, a change of £7,585 or 21.0%, in cash terms, not adjusted for inflation (ONS).

People claiming unemployment-related benefits
In Woking, people claiming unemployment-related benefits rose from 405 in January 2017 to 1,845 in July 2026, a change of 1,440 or 355.6% (ONS).
